Output 581d1d39dee742c1fa968ffda1fe2f9692bdd1d8cd8044d5d05bd9100c8c76be:24

value
3580333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2e21f6d37ee437028f9737a19de701ab71a345e OP_EQUAL
address
3Hzs5yU71p4PxSBQWecwqE2opEEtrkJBWx
transaction
581d1d39dee742c1fa968ffda1fe2f9692bdd1d8cd8044d5d05bd9100c8c76be
spent
true